Transaction 73e3a30e8f367e53ef218b5db2325698cd4ca5bf018339a364fdad048f527201
1 Input
2 Outputs
- 73e3a30e8f367e53ef218b5db2325698cd4ca5bf018339a364fdad048f527201:0
- 73e3a30e8f367e53ef218b5db2325698cd4ca5bf018339a364fdad048f527201:1
value 1543724
address 1MmyWxaHpVGHuxnYk4oGZSZCwFTCeivLHx
value 2011500
address 1CxLqyJydLE5rax986vx9x4J1gduDLtBHq